Transaction 345710136b2e216fcdf35bbd580e6919c8829ed21a48e7f81b8bcf6b7e26d288

9 Input
2 Outputs
  • 345710136b2e216fcdf35bbd580e6919c8829ed21a48e7f81b8bcf6b7e26d288:0
  • value  600000
    address  3PPcxQt4zt7rLANMks2MKGnqDV48sAM9JH
  • 345710136b2e216fcdf35bbd580e6919c8829ed21a48e7f81b8bcf6b7e26d288:1
  • value  3089200
    address  bc1q3s2ukxzsdgq8cj75rlj76k3asah8kjyjrarh6j